Output 422d79bfcd63309033568e50a2966fa910f620fe13221b87d4c5533c8511057c:75

value
1788314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fe89ce6cb1266fac13457910a88adb48a6dfde3 OP_EQUAL
address
3N6wGYpE4CnKswDcwKViy9tMUezgv2CD3B
transaction
422d79bfcd63309033568e50a2966fa910f620fe13221b87d4c5533c8511057c
spent
true